2019-04-20 14:33:11 +00:00
|
|
|
codecov:
|
2024-08-12 13:13:54 +00:00
|
|
|
require_ci_to_pass: true
|
2019-04-20 14:33:11 +00:00
|
|
|
notify:
|
2021-04-12 16:03:26 +00:00
|
|
|
after_n_builds: 3
|
2024-08-12 13:13:54 +00:00
|
|
|
wait_for_ci: true
|
2019-04-20 14:33:11 +00:00
|
|
|
|
2019-05-05 12:11:52 +00:00
|
|
|
coverage:
|
|
|
|
status:
|
|
|
|
project: off
|
2019-05-19 11:06:21 +00:00
|
|
|
patch:
|
|
|
|
default:
|
|
|
|
threshold: 0.01
|
2019-05-05 12:11:52 +00:00
|
|
|
|
2019-04-20 14:33:11 +00:00
|
|
|
comment:
|
|
|
|
layout: "diff, files"
|
|
|
|
behavior: default
|
2024-08-12 13:13:54 +00:00
|
|
|
require_changes: true # if true: only post the comment if coverage changes
|
|
|
|
require_base: false # [true :: must have a base report to post]
|
|
|
|
require_head: true # [true :: must have a head report to post]
|
2023-05-05 18:05:20 +00:00
|
|
|
branches:
|
2021-03-22 13:02:31 +00:00
|
|
|
- master
|
2021-04-12 16:03:26 +00:00
|
|
|
after_n_builds: 3
|
2019-04-20 14:33:11 +00:00
|
|
|
|
2024-08-12 13:13:54 +00:00
|
|
|
github_checks:
|
|
|
|
annotations: false
|
|
|
|
|
2019-05-05 12:11:52 +00:00
|
|
|
flags:
|
|
|
|
# filter the folder(s) you wish to measure by that flag
|
|
|
|
api:
|
|
|
|
paths:
|
|
|
|
- api/
|
|
|
|
library:
|
|
|
|
paths:
|
|
|
|
- lib/
|
|
|
|
client:
|
|
|
|
paths:
|
|
|
|
- client/
|
|
|
|
- clientgui/
|
|
|
|
server:
|
|
|
|
paths:
|
|
|
|
- sched/
|
|
|
|
- db/
|
|
|
|
- tools/
|
2020-03-26 09:30:54 +00:00
|
|
|
android:
|
|
|
|
paths:
|
|
|
|
- android/BOINC/app/src/main/java/edu/berkeley/boinc
|
2019-05-05 12:11:52 +00:00
|
|
|
|
|
|
|
# don't gather statistics for test and external libraries
|
2019-04-20 14:33:11 +00:00
|
|
|
ignore:
|
|
|
|
- tests/.*
|
|
|
|
- zip/.*
|
|
|
|
- 3rdParty/.*
|